What is entailed in a bathroom redesign?
A bathroom reconstruct consists of changing several existing components, devices, coverings, and completions in a room to give it an updated look. It can vary from quite straightforward endeavors that update an ancient bathroom with new tile or a new vanity to complicated many-component jobs of the whole room.In any case, there are a few basic steps you can expect in the majority of bathroom remodels.
The full process of changing all parts and endings requires some understanding of plumbing, woodwork, and electrics. Also, guidelines from your local building section may necessitate the help of an accredited builder. You should consult with your developer or planner first to learn more about these details."
Is there anything I need to do before a bathroom redesign?
You should select the components you wish well beforehand of your reconstruct. If the designs or colors are not in stock, it may be essential to delay your remodeling until they are back in inventory. Also, decide whether you want to do a complete overhaul and eliminate all current components and completions before the redesign commences.
Taking out everything will save time on the reconstruction, but it will also demand more storage space. Your developer should be capable to offer advice on this vital question.
How long will the bathroom reconstruct take?
Nearly all domestic bathrooms are completed within 7-12 days after all work order approvals have been secured from your community construction division and subcontractors are set for site meetings.

What is the optimal width and longness for a walk-in shower?
Anything below than 30" wide is not advised, as it's tough to get in and out of. A 36" in width shower is typically a preferred width for most people. As much as length goes – the regular size is 5 feet, but anything from 3 to 6 feet in length would be fine if you have the space.

What is the finest flooring for bathrooms?
Ceramic tile is almost always an excellent option for floors in bathrooms and other wet areas. The grout lines can be sealed with a sealant that will assist ward off mold expansion and water damage. Marble is a different beneficial flooring option for bathrooms. If the marble is processed, it can be used outdoors as well. With a glossed surface, and nice sheen, it demands fewer upkeep than different stone varieties. Stone slabs or pavers will endure basically forever but are not always very cushioned on bare feet (because of their sharp sides).
